Xanthocephalum is a genus of North American plants in the tribe Astereae within the family Asteraceae.
The name "Xanthocephalum" means "yellow head," from the Greek "xanthos," yellow and "kephale," head. The genus was once much larger than it is today, with many of its former members transferred to Gutierrezia in the 1980s. Species Xanthocephalum amoenum Shinners - Texas Xanthocephalum benthamianum Hemsl. - Aguascalientes, San Luis Potosí, Chihuahua, Durango, Michoacán, Jalisco Xanthocephalum centauroides Willd. - Michoacán, Durango, D.F., Guanajuato, México State Xanthocephalum durangense M.A.Lane - Durango Xanthocephalum eradiatum (M.A.Lane) G.L.Nesom - Chihuahua Xanthocephalum gymnospermoides (A.Gray) Benth. & Hook.f. - United States (Arizona, Texas), Chihuahua, Sonora Xanthocephalum humile (Kunth) Benth. & Hook.f. - Hidalgo, D.F., Puebla, Tlaxcala, México State, San Luis Potosí Xanthocephalum megalocephalum Fernald - Chihuahua formerly included see Amphiachyris Gutierrezia Gymnosperma Pilosella Stephanodoria
